11 February2000 VENEZUELA: FLOODS appeal no. 35/99 situation report no. 8 period covered: 18 January - 7 February 2000 The Federation, the Venezuelan Red Cross and Participating National Societies are increasing the scope of emergency relief assistance to flood victims. It includes food, clean water, health care and psychological support. The bad weather is continuing in some areas, causing further damage and adding to logistical difficulties. The disaster Weeks of torrential rains in Venezuela at the end of 1999 caused massive landslides and severe flooding in seven northern states. The official death toll is 30,000 but other sources put the figure as high as 50,000. Over 600,000 persons are estimated to have been directly affected and according to the Venezuelan Civil Defence’s initial damage assessments at least 64,700 houses have been damaged and over 23,200 destroyed. Update A state of alert is still in effect in the State of Vargas as rains continue in the mountains. Eight districts are still only accessible by air. The cave-in of one lane of the highway to El Junquito has cut off seven towns. The collapse of the highway between Morón and Coro has isolated the state of Falcón. Twenty four new landslides and floods were recorded during the past week. A growing lagoon has built up above Caracas because of debris blocking the rivers. The authorities have started to demolish condemned homes and shanty houses built in dangerous areas such as ravines and canyons because warmer weather is producing cracks in the mud banks and badly damaged homes are collapsing under their own weight. -

CRECIMIENTO POBLACIONAL Y CAMBIOS CONTEMPORÁNEOS (1547-2000) Armando Luis Martínez Resumen La historia urbana de Valencia se caracteriza por el predominio de un lento crecimiento poblacional. La ciudad colonial fue pequeña, contaba con escasas construcciones de una sola planta, modestas, y en sus alrededores habían casas hechas de bahareque y techos de paja. La cuadrícula de origen hispano fue el punto de partida del crecimiento urbano posterior. En el siglo XIX se mantuvo una tendencia a un crecimiento modesto de la población hasta la década comprendida entre 1881-1891, durante la cual ocurrió un incremento de la población estimulado por las inversiones en el sector secundario. A principios del siglo XX el establecimiento de las empresas textiles significó un estímulo económico y una atracción para la población que se estableció en la ciudad. Con la industrialización basada en la sustitución de importaciones esta tendencia se acentúa, en medio de una urbanización convulsiva que determinará la integración de la ciudad a la gran megalópolis del centro. Martínez5, Erick Hernández8, Francis Bertuglia7, Omaira Andrade7, Jaime Torres3, Jürgen May1, Silvia Herrera‑Leon2 & Daniel Eibach1 In 2016, Venezuela faced a large diphtheria outbreak that extended until 2019. Nasopharyngeal or oropharyngeal samples were prospectively collected from 51 suspected cases and retrospective data from 348 clinical records was retrieved from 14 hospitals between November 2017 and November 2018. Confrmed pathogenic Corynebactrium isolates were biotyped. Multilocus Sequence Typing (MLST) was performed followed by next‑generation‑based core genome‑MLST and minimum spanning trees were generated. Subjects between 10 and 19 years of age were mostly afected (n = 95; 27.3%). Case fatality rates (CFR) were higher in males (19.4%), as compared to females (15.8%). The highest CFR (31.1%) was observed among those under 5, followed by the 40 to 49 age‑group (25.0%). Nine samples corresponded to C. diphtheriae and 1 to C. ulcerans. Two Sequencing Types (ST), ST174 and ST697 (the latter not previously described) were identifed among the eight C. diphtheriae isolates from Carabobo state. Cg‑MLST revealed only one cluster also from Carabobo. The Whole Genome Sequencing analysis revealed that the outbreak seemed to be caused by diferent strains with C. diphtheriae and C. ulcerans coexisting. The reemergence and length of this outbreak suggest vaccination coverage problems and an inadequate control strategy. -

NATIONAL MUSEUM Vol. 87 Washington : 1939 No, 3073 OBSERVATIONS ON THE BIRDS OF NORTPIERN VENEZUELA By Alexander Wetmore An extended journey in the southern republics of South America several years ago aroused a wish to know something in life of the birds of the northern section of that great continent, a desire that was finally gratified in the latter part of 1937 when arrangement was made for field work in Venezuela. In brief, in this second journey work began at the seacoast 50 miles west of La Guaira, was extended inland to the higher levels of the CordiUera de la Costa at Rancho Grande, and, with brief observations at Maracay in the valley of Aragua, was concluded with a stay at El Sombrero in the northern Orinoco Valley 80 miles due south of the capital city of Caracas. The studies thus included a transit through the arid tropical zone of the north coast, the subtropical rain forests of the coast range, the open valley of Aragua, and the northern section of the llanos down to that point where the blanket of thorny scrub that extends south- ward from the hills on the northern boundary of that great level plain begins to open out in the vast savannas that reach toward the Rio Orinoco. The collections from the region included in the Parque Naciondl serve as a link to join work done by earlier investigators in the region of the Cumbre de Valencia and Puerto Cabello in Estado Carabobo, and in the vicinity of Caracas. -

Z. Geomorph. N.F. Suppl.-Vol. 145 147-175 Berlin Stuttgart October 2006 Geomorphic effects of large debris flows and flash floods, northern Venezuela, 1999 MATTHEW C. LARSEN and GERALD F. WIECZOREK with 10 figures and 2 tables Summary. A rare, high-magnitude storm in northern Venezuela in December 1999 triggered debris flows and flash floods, and caused one of the worst natural disasters in the recorded history of the Americas. Some 15,000 people were killed. The debris flows and floods inundated coastal communities on alluvial fans at the mouths of a coastal mountain drainage network and destroyed property estimated at more than $2 billion. Landslides were abundant and widespread on steep slopes within areas underlain by schist and gneiss from near the coast to slightly over the crest of the mountain range. Some hillsides were entirely denuded by single or coalescing failures, which formed massive debris flows in river channels flowing out onto densely populated alluvial fans at the coast. The massive amount of sediment derived from 24 watersheds along 50 km of the coast during the storm and deposited on alluvial fans and beaches has been estimated at 15 to 20 million m3. Sediment yield for the 1999 storm from the approximately 200 km2 drainage area of watersheds upstream of the alluvial fans was as much as 100,000 m3/km2. Rapid economic development in this dynamic geomorphic environment close to the capital city of Caracas, in combination with a severe rain storm, resulted in the death of approximately 5% of the population (300,000 total prior to the storm) in the northern Venezuelan state of Vargas. -

The genus Guzmania (Bromeliaceae) in Venezuela Compiled by Yuribia Vivas Fundación Instituto Botánico de Venezuela Bruce Holst & Harry Luther Marie Selby Botanical Gardens The genus Guzmania was described by Hipólito Ruiz and José Pavón in 1802 in the "Flora Peruviana et Chilensis." The type species is Guzmania tricolor Ruiz & Pav. The name honors Spanish naturalist Anastasio Guzmán, a student of South American plants and animals (Grant & Zijlstra 1998). Species of Guzmania are distributed from the southern USA (Florida) and Mexico to Brazil and Peru, including the Most species of Guzmania are found in cloud forests at middle elevations. Antilles; they are largely absent from lowland Amazonia. Photograph by Yuribia Vivas. Figure modified from Smith & Downs, Flora Neotropica. Guzmania is placed in the subfamily Tillandsioideae, and is distinguished from other members of the subfamily (Vriesea,Tillandsia, Catopsis, Racinaea, Alcantarea, Mezobromelia, and Werauhia) by having polystichously arranged flowers (that is, arranged in many planes on the inflorescence axis), white, whitish, yellow, or greenish petals that lack nectar scales, and having generally reddish brown-colored seeds. In general aspect, Guzmania is difficult to distinguish from Mezobromelia since both are polystichously flowered and may have similar color schemes, but the presence of nectar scales in Mezobromelia and absence inGuzmania separates them. Approximately 200 species and 17 varieties of Guzmania are known, making it the third largest genus in the subfamily, after Tillandsia and Vriesea.
